Netflix users are correcting a misconception about The Witcher season three. The latest run of the fantasy series starring Henry Cavill as Geralt of Rivia, a monster-hunting character based in a world known as The Continent, debuted on Thursday 29 June. While the new season has been acclaimed, many viewers criticised the season for being too short. However, unbeknownst to them, this is merely the first volume of a two-part season. It has since been pointed out by other fans that the concluding five episodes will be released on 27 July.

One must take Andrzej Sapkowski's comment with a generous grain of salt, of course. The author does not express any explicit dislike toward Netflix's The Witcher adaptation, and Sapkowski has actually offered more positive opinions on the live-action TV show in the past. Andrzej Sapkowski has historically also remained cool on the immensely popular The Witcher video game series, so the Netflix TV show finds itself in good company, at least.
